Vercel AI SDK快速构建聊天机器人
Vercel AI SDK快速构建聊天机器人
官方文档地址:Documentation - Vercel AI SDK

本次构建选择基于NEXT.js框架、OpenAI以及Vercel AI SDK实现一个聊天机器人
点击图中的”Next.js OpenAI Starter“来到以下页面

点击Deploy按钮,进入Vercel的部署页面【需要Vercel账号及Github账号绑定】
Repository Name是项目创建的仓库名,部署在Github上,默认是vercel-ai-chat-openai,修改完后点击Create等待创建完成

需要输入OpenAI Key后点击Deploy部署

部署完成后是如下页面,点击左边看似空白的框即可进入到网站聊天界面

网站聊天机器人页面如下
进行简单的提问,输出了流式的回答
需要注意的是OpenAI Key过期后,网站仍然可以访问,但提问后不会有回答出现。如进行提问后没有生成回复,请检查OpenAI Key是否过期,再查看网络是否有问题。

这个项目本身的页面非常简洁,如需要进行修改,可以到以下网站中

这个网站可以根据提示词,自动生成UI组件。v0和Vercel AI SDK都是Vercel发布的,v0生成的UI组件代码可以很方便地集成到创建地Web应用中,不需要切换UI组件库。
本博客所有文章除特别声明外,均采用 CC BY-NC-SA 4.0 许可协议。转载请注明来自 Catmint!
评论
